AvalonBay Communities (NYSE:AVB) 2025 Conference Transcript

AvalonBay Communities Conference Call Summary Company Overview - Company: AvalonBay Communities (NYSE: AVB) - Event: 2025 Global Real Estate Conference - Date: September 09, 2025 Key Highlights Financial Performance - Q2 same-store NOI guidance increased by 40 basis points to 2.7% [2] - Core FFO earnings guidance reaffirmed at 3.5%, among the highest in the sector [2] - Revenue expectations for the quarter are tracking as planned [2] Portfolio Positioning - Strong demand and occupancy in suburban coastal regions, with supply decreasing [3] - Expected deliveries as a percentage of stock to drop to 80 basis points, the lowest in over a decade [3] - Ongoing portfolio repositioning to increase suburban allocation from 70% to 80% and expand into select markets [4] Asset Transactions - Engaged in $900 million of asset transactions, including a $450 million sale in the D.C. area [5] - Shifted focus within the Mid-Atlantic region, reducing exposure from 15% to 11% [5][6] Development Strategy - Current development book trending above pro forma, with construction costs decreasing significantly [6] - Anticipated development NOI of approximately $25 million for the year, with expected growth in 2026 and 2027 [7] - Targeting $1.7 billion in development starts, with 40% allocated to the West Coast [31] Market Dynamics - Leasing season peaked earlier than expected, with rent growth reaching 4.5% before leveling off [12] - Job growth composition has been less favorable, impacting demand in established regions [13] - Mid-Atlantic region showing signs of softness, while other areas like New York City and San Francisco remain strong [15][16] Regulatory Environment - Heightened regulatory scrutiny, particularly around rent control and fee transparency [45][48] - Focus on supply-based solutions to address housing issues, with a commitment to affordable housing in developments [46] Balance Sheet and Capital Management - Strong balance sheet with $1.3 billion raised at an initial cost of 5% [8] - Net debt to EBITDA ratio at 4.4 times, indicating capacity for additional leverage if needed [39] - Flexibility to issue both five-year and ten-year debt to support growth [44] Future Outlook - Optimistic about the second half of 2025 and into 2026, with a focus on maintaining strong operating fundamentals [9] - Anticipation of continued demand for rental properties due to affordability issues in home buying [20][21] Additional Insights - No significant changes in household mix or financial stress indicators noted [24] - Transaction market remains active, with cap rates generally in the range of 4.75% to 5.75% [26] - Development costs have decreased by approximately 5% year-over-year, with some markets seeing reductions of up to 10% [34] This summary encapsulates the key points discussed during the conference call, highlighting AvalonBay Communities' financial performance, strategic initiatives, market dynamics, and outlook for the future.
